What it does
What
RecreationWho
Elderly/old PeopleThe General Public/mankindHow
Provides Buildings/facilities/open SpaceCharitable objects
THE OBJECTS FOR WHICH THE CHARITY IS ESTABLISHED ARE: TO PROMOTE FOR THE BENEFIT OF THE INHABITANTS OF RHONDDA WARD AND SURROUNDING AREAS THE PROVISION OF FACILITIES FOR RECREATION OR OTHER LEISURE TIME OR OCCUPATION OF INDIVIDUALS WHO HAVE NEED OF SUCH FACILITIES BY REASON OF THEIR YOUTH, AGE, INFIRMITY OR DISABLEMENT, FINANCIAL HARDSHIP OR SOCIAL AND ECONOMIC CIRCUMSTANCES OR FOR THE PUBLIC AT LARGE IN THE INTERESTS OF SOCIAL WELFARE AND WITH THE OBJECT OF IMPROVING WELLBEING AND THE CONDITIONS OF LIFE OF THE SAID INHABITANTS.TO ADVANCE EDUCATION IN THE SUBJECTS OF EXPRESSIVE ARTS AND RELATED ACTIVITIES TO SUPPORT THE HEALTH AND WELLBEING OF THE PUBLIC AT LARGE WITH THE OBJECT OF IMPROVING QUALITY OF LIFE AND SOCIAL COHESION.THE PROVISION AND MAINTENANCE OF HOPKINSTOWN COMMUNITY HALL FOR THE USE OF THE COMMUNITY OF RHONDDA WARD AND SURROUNDING AREAS WITHOUT DISTINCTION OF POLITICAL, RELIGIOUS, OR OTHER OPINIONS, INCLUDING USE FOR:A. MEETINGS, LECTURES, AND CLASSES, ANDB. OTHER FORMS OF RECREATION AND LEISURE-TIME OCCUPATION, WITH THE OBJECT OF IMPROVING THE CONDITIONS OF LIFE FOR THE COMMUNITY.
Governing document: CONSTITUTION ADOPTED 6TH FEBRUARY 1953.AS AMENDED BY RESOLUTION DATED 10 JUN 2021
